What Is the Highest Earning Potential for Drivers?
Since a driver’s income in Senegal doesn’t have fixed hours, how much they’ll earn may not be the same as well. But aren’t you curious about how profitable this can be? So, let us discuss the different factors that affect your payout in Senegal, how you can boost yours, and what potential challenges you need to prepare for.

Factors That Influence a Driver’s Maximum Revenue

Our top earning drivers are able to earn a lot because of these two things:

Working in High-Demand Zones

Working in Senegal’s airports and tourist areas where the demand for your services is great for maximizing a driver’s revenue because:

  • You benefit from surge pricing. So, even for the same distance, you’ll be making more.
  • You’ll get a booking right away. Since there’s a high demand, you don’t have to wait long to get a booking.
  • There’s a higher chance of tipping. A driver’s income in Senegal can also be boosted by tips from tourists and business professionals.
  • Let us be clear. A lot of top earning drivers using Yango still work outside these zones. But in general, it’s easier to earn more here.

Specializing in Premium Services

Yango supports different vehicle classes in Senegal, with the more expensive ones considered to come with premium services too. So, if you’re driving one of these premium vehicles, you may get a higher than average driver income in Senegal. But it’s not just about the vehicle. If you’re very professional and are keeping your car in top-condition, you can deliver a more premium experience. For you, this means a higher chance of getting a tip!

How to Boost Your Income as a Driver

If you want to maximize your driver revenue, we have a few suggestions that you can follow:

  • Work when there’s a low supply. For example, even if the demand isn’t at its peak late at night, not a lot of drivers may be on the road. This means that the balance of supply and demand is still in your favor.
  • Work in high-demand zones. A driver’s income in Senegal can easily be boosted by surge pricing.
  • Provide excellent customer service. Passengers are more likely to tip if they’re happy about the experience.
  • Consider working longer hours. While we don’t recommend working yourself to the bone, this is a sure way to maximize your driver revenue.
  • Watch out for promotions.At the beginning of your shift, make sure to claim any Yango Pro promotions that are available for you.

With these, you can boost your income potential.

Challenges of Reaching Peak Earnings

Part of maximizing your payout is learning about what challenges may prevent you from making more on Senegalese roads:

  • High competition. If there are a lot of drivers in the area, it may take a while for you to get a passenger.
  • igh traffic congestion. This makes an average trip longer, which means you get to book fewer passengers per shift.
  • Difficult passengers. They may come up with every excuse to prevent paying you or to not leave a tip.

If you encounter any of these, don’t worry! Even top earning drivers have to deal with these. In the end, it’s all about how you address the situation to limit their effects.
